Few materials offer the combination of performance and beauty that copper provides.
Unlike painted metals or manufactured finishes, copper evolves over time. The bright finish seen on installation gradually deepens and matures, creating a look that cannot be replicated with other materials. Properly installed copper gutters and flashing can last for generations, making them a popular choice for high-end custom homes throughout Fairfield County and Westchester County.
